Footsteps from the Past I – Yard behind the Woodworking Shop on Duke of Gloucester Street.

Description

Two women gather ingredients they will use to prepare a meal for the merchant they served. In the hierarchy of slave labor, cooks had a degree of authority and security not experienced by most other slaves.  They shopped and were often able to sign for the household account.[1]
